Red River Brick is the premiere brand of the General Shale network in the Southwest U.S. Drawing its name from the Red River of the South, Red River Brick includes eight production sites across key brick markets in Texas and Oklahoma, with more than 70 unique residential and commercial design offerings distributed through eight direct retail centers.
